两个让我头痛的问题
在一个由SW1、SW2、SW3三台交换机组成的环路中,SW1的0/26端口连接SW2的0/26端口,SW1的0/27端口连接SW3的0/26端口,SW2的0/27端口连接SW3的0/27端口。<br><br>在稳定状态下,除了SW3的0/27端口处于阻塞状态以外,其余各交换机的各端口均处于转发状态。<br><br>问题一:由于处于阻塞状态下的端口不能转发和接收数据帧,但仍可转发和接收BPDU,那么在这个环路中的稳定状态下,根网桥所发送的Hello数据包会从两条路径到达SW2的两个不同端口,从两条路径到达SW3的两个不同端口。那么此时SW2和SW3各自收到两个BPDU,那么他们将怎么处理?是否会同时转发两个COST值不同的BPDU?在此环路中BPDU是否会发生循环呢?<br><br>问题二:当SW1的0/27与SW3的0/26端口连接所组成的网段发生故障时,STP会进行收敛,结果为SW3的0/27处于转发状态,0/26处于阻塞状态。那么当故障网段恢复正常以后,STP是否会有所反应?如果有,会是什么反应? 我明白了,谢谢 各位不好意思,我没办法直接把网络拓朴图帖上来,请各位好心人耐心的看下去,小生这边谢了!!!!!! 关于STP<br>1、一个网络只能有一个根桥;<br>2、每个非根桥只能有一个根端口,根桥的端口全为指定端口;<br>3、每个网段只能有一个指定端口,且处于转发状态;<br>4、非指定端口处于禁用状态。<br> 问题二解决了,那问题一呢? BPDU有两种类型:<br>1.配置BPDU 2.拓扑改变通知TCN BPDU<br>第一种是从root bridge发出的,遍历所以活动的路径,用来提供BID和COST;TCN BPDU向root bridge去,用于通知topology的改变,重新计算STP,收敛后TCN消失。<br><br>Blocking status,不参与forwarding ,但接收来BPDU并发送给STP处理。
页:
[1]